Benefits of Ebook Textbooks

One of the most significant advantages of ebooks is their accessibility. Students can access their textbooks from virtually anywhere with an internet connection, making it easier to study on-the-go or while traveling. Additionally, ebook textbooks are often significantly cheaper than their print counterparts, which can be a major benefit for students who are struggling to afford costly textbooks.

Drawbacks of Ebook Textbooks

While ebook textbooks have many benefits, there are also some drawbacks to consider. For example, not all students may have access to the technology required to read ebooks, such as a tablet or e-reader. Additionally, reading large amounts of text on a screen can be tiring on the eyes, which can lead to fatigue and decreased retention of information.

Interactive Features of Ebook Textbooks

One of the most exciting aspects of ebook textbooks is the ability to include interactive features such as videos, animations, and quizzes. These features can help students better understand complex concepts and engage with the material in a more meaningful way. Additionally, many ebook platforms offer note-taking and highlighting tools that can make studying more efficient.

Concerns about Copyright and Ownership

One of the biggest concerns with ebook textbooks is the issue of copyright and ownership. Unlike physical textbooks, which can be resold or shared, ebook textbooks are often subject to strict copyright laws that limit how they can be accessed and distributed. This can be frustrating for students who may feel like they are being forced to pay for access to materials that they don't actually own.

Impact on the Environment

Another benefit of ebook textbooks is their positive impact on the environment. Traditional textbooks require significant amounts of paper and ink to produce, which can lead to deforestation and pollution. By contrast, ebooks are digital and have a much smaller environmental footprint. This makes them a more sustainable option for students who are concerned about the impact of their consumption habits.

Accessibility Concerns for Students with Disabilities

While ebook textbooks may be more accessible for some students, they can also present challenges for those with disabilities. For example, students with visual impairments may struggle to read text on a screen, even with assistive technology. Similarly, students with mobility impairments may find it difficult to navigate complex ebook interfaces. It is important for educators and publishers to consider these concerns when developing and distributing ebook textbooks.

Secondly, we encourage students to explore different online resources that offer free or affordable access to textbooks. There are various websites and platforms that provide access to digital textbooks, such as OpenStax, Bookboon, and Project Gutenberg, among others. Furthermore, you can also consider renting textbooks from online vendors like Chegg or Amazon, which can save you money and provide you with temporary access to the required material.

Many people wonder about the benefits of using ebook textbooks. Here are some common questions people ask about ebook textbooks, along with answers:

  • What are ebook textbooks?

    Ebook textbooks are digital versions of traditional textbooks that can be read on electronic devices such as tablets, laptops, and e-readers.

  • What are the advantages of using ebook textbooks?

    - Ebook textbooks are often cheaper than physical textbooks

    - They are portable and lightweight, making them easier to carry around

    - They can be easily searched for specific information

    - They are eco-friendly, as they do not require paper or ink to produce

  • Are ebook textbooks as effective as physical textbooks?

    Studies have shown that there is little difference in learning outcomes between students who use ebook textbooks and those who use physical textbooks. However, some students may prefer the tactile experience of reading a physical textbook.

  • Can ebook textbooks be accessed without an internet connection?

    Yes, once downloaded onto a device, ebook textbooks can be accessed without an internet connection.

  • Are all textbooks available in ebook format?

    No, not all textbooks are available in ebook format. However, many publishers are now offering ebook versions of their textbooks.
